    Universal Institute of Engineering and Technology, Mohali offers a total of 10 degree courses in full-time mode. UIET Mohali courses are offered at undergraduate and postgraduate levels.  UIET Mohali UG courses include B.E/B.Tech courses in five different specialisations. 

    UIET Mohali PG courses are ME/MTech offered with four different specialisations and MBA. UIET Mohali course structure includes workshops, and projects whenever changes are made syllabus is updated accordingly. The courses at the Universal Institute of Engineering and Technology, Mohali are offered in the specialisation of Civil Engineering, Computer Science Engineering and more.

    UIET Mohali Fees 2025

    Universal Institute of Engineering and Technology Mohali fee structure is followed as per the guidelines of the Punjab government. The details of the courses offered and eligibility criteria are mentioned in the table below:

    Universal Institute of Engineering and Technology, Mohali Courses and Eligibility Criteria

    Courses

    Eligibility Criteria

    BE/BTech

    10+2/12/Intermediate from a recognised board. 

    ME/MTech

    Bachelor's degree in relevant stream or Associate Member of Institute of Engineers (AMIE).  

    MBA

    Note: Candidates who have passed a diploma in Engineering trade from the Punjab State Board of Technical Education, Chandigarh or any equivalent qualification are eligible to apply for a B.Tech course at the institute.
